In Article 11 of Regulation (EU) 2019/787, paragraph 3 is replaced by the following:
‘3. Compound terms describing an alcoholic beverage shall:
(a)
appear in uniform characters of the same font, size and colour;
(b)
not be interrupted by any textual or pictorial element which does not form part of them;
(c)
not appear in a font size which is larger than the font size used for the name of the alcoholic beverage; and
(d)
in cases where the alcoholic beverage is a spirit drink, always be accompanied by the legal name of the spirit drink, which shall appear in the same visual field as the compound term, unless the legal name is replaced by a compound term in accordance with Article 10(5), point (b).’.
